STATEMENT CONDEMNING THE BRUTAL AND
SENSELESS KILLING OF
ROGERIO “ONNIE” MINGOY, JR.
We, the members of Lay Forum Philippines in the entire country, condemn the brutal and senseless killing of one of our active member of the National Coordinating Group and presently the Municipal Administrator of the Municipality of Baleno, Masbate, Rogerio “Onnie” Mingoy Jr.
On August 31, 2010 at 1:00 p.m., while Onnie, 54 years old, was riding his bicycle on his way to his office, an unknown assailant from behind riding a motorcycle shot Onnie twice at the back with his short firearm which instantaneously killed him. This happened at Barangay Potoson in front of the Municipal Cemetery, Municipality of Baleno, Masbate.
Onnie, as we fondly called him, was a Lay person with principles. He was a spiritual person, a man full of dignity. He always loved the poor, deprived and the oppressed. He is well known to us as a staunch activist opposing mining to be implemented in his municipality.
As a partner and active member of the Lay Forum Philippines, he is well loved. He will always ask questions during meetings that tickle our mind to think for the best options for our group and for the poor. For him the concerns of the poor, deprived and oppressed are also the concerns of the Lay Forum Philippines. He always encourages us to face issues confronting the laity. Oftentimes, telling us that he is proud to be a member of the Lay Forum Philippines because this group is one of the sources of his strength.
On the broad daylight last August 31, 2010, he was treacherously murdered.
